Securing tax benefits while contributing to worthy causes is a win-win situation. Under India's Income Tax Act, donations made to registered charitable organizations under Section 80G can potentially lower your tax liability. These generous contributions offer significant financial incentives for individuals who wish to support social development. By making an 80G donation, you not only contribute to a laudable cause but also enjoy significant tax deductions, effectively enhancing your overall savings.

  • Ensure the organization is registered under Section 80G of the Income Tax Act.
  • Acquire a valid receipt for your donation.
  • Report the donation accurately in your income tax return.

Donation Accounting: Journal Entries for Charitable Giving

Proper tracking of charitable donations is essential for both legal compliance and transparent reporting. When an beneficiary makes a gift, the appropriate journal entries must be made to reflect the transaction accurately in the financial ledger.

Typically, a donation will be acknowledged as a gain in the organization's income statement. The corresponding asset increase reflects the funds received.

For example, if an entity donates $10,000 in cash to a non-profit charity, the journal entry would entail the following:

* Debit: Cash account - $10,000

* Credit: Donations revenue - $10,000

This record ensures that both the increase in cash assets and the corresponding increase in revenue are shown accurately.

Moreover, there are instances where more complex journal entries may be necessary. For example, if a donation is made with limitations on its use, separate accounts must be created to track the restricted funds and ensure compliance with the donor's wishes.

Therefore, understanding the principles of donation accounting and journal entries is crucial for non-profit institutions to maintain accurate financial records, comply with regulatory requirements, and effectively manage their resources.

Essential Guide: Donation Receipts and Tax Deductions

When donating to a charitable organization, it's important to preserve a receipt for your records. These receipts serve as documentation of your generosity and can be used to reduce your taxable income on your tax filing.

  • Confirm that the receipt includes the organization's name, date of donation, and the amount contributed.
  • Review your tax advisor or the IRS website for specific guidelines on charitable deductions.
  • Organize your receipts effectively for easy retrieval during tax season.

By observing these tips, you can enhance your tax benefits while supporting the causes you believe about.
